Occurs in shallow and medium depths of large rivers, usually caught as scattered representatives in schools of the other species in this genus. Feeds mostly on zooplankton and occasionally insects. Used to make prahoc .
Lateral line continuous; nearly straight dorsal profile; 41-56 gill rakers on the first arch .: fusiform / normal.
